iT邦幫忙

鐵人檔案

2025 iThome 鐵人賽
回列表
自我挑戰組

LeetCode 每日一題挑戰 系列

打開 LeetCode,看今天要做哪一題
題目不一定很難,重點是每天都動一下腦子,把刷題當成 日常小習慣。
有時候題目簡單就很快完成,有時候卡關就慢慢想,但總之每天都有一點進步

參賽天數 0 天 | 共 30 篇文章 | 1 人訂閱 訂閱系列文 RSS系列文
DAY 0

Day 21 - Find the Index of the First Occurrence in a String

題目 給定兩個字串 needle 和 haystack,請找出 needle 在 haystack 中第一次出現的位置,並返回該位置的索引值;如果 needle...

2025-10-10 ‧ 由 aydan3199 分享
DAY 0

Day 22 — Divide Two Integers

題目 給定兩個整數 dividend 和 divisor,要求 不使用乘法、除法和 mod 運算,實現兩個整數的除法。結果需要向零截斷(丟掉小數部分)。 注意:...

2025-10-10 ‧ 由 aydan3199 分享
DAY 0

Day 23 — Substring with Concatenation of All Words

題目 給定一個字串 s 和一個單字陣列 words,所有單字的長度相同。要求找出 s 中所有包含 words 任意排列組合連接的子字串的起始索引,並回傳這些索引...

2025-10-10 ‧ 由 aydan3199 分享
DAY 0

Day 24 — Next Permutation

題目 給定一個整數陣列 nums,找出它的 下一個排列(lexicographically larger permutation)。如果不存在更大的排列,則將它...

2025-10-10 ‧ 由 aydan3199 分享
DAY 0

Day 25 — Longest Valid Parentheses

題目 給定一個只包含 '(' 和 ')' 的字串,返回其中 最長的有效括號子串長度。 範例 Input: "(()"Output: 2Exp...

2025-10-10 ‧ 由 aydan3199 分享
DAY 0

Day26 Search in Rotated Sorted Array

題目說明 給定一個原本升序排列、但被旋轉過的整數陣列 nums,以及一個目標值 target。請你在陣列中找出 target 的索引,若不存在則回傳 -1。演算...

2025-10-13 ‧ 由 aydan3199 分享
DAY 0

Day 27 — Find First and Last Position of Element in Sorted Array

題目說明 給定一個 非遞減排序(升序) 的整數陣列 nums,找出目標值 target 出現的第一個與最後一個索引位置。如果目標值不存在,回傳 [-1, -1]...

2025-10-13 ‧ 由 aydan3199 分享
DAY 0

Day 28 —Search Insert Position

題目說明 給定一個 升序排列且不重複的整數陣列 nums,以及一個目標值 target。 請找出: 如果 target 存在於陣列中,回傳它的索引位置; 如果不...

2025-10-13 ‧ 由 aydan3199 分享
DAY 0

Day 29— Count and Say

題目說明 這題的重點是要產生 Count and Say 序列。它是一個根據「上一項」描述「數字出現次數」的遞迴序列。 定義如下: countAndSay(1)...

2025-10-14 ‧ 由 aydan3199 分享

鐵人賽 Day 30 — 最後一天!心得與收穫

終於來到鐵人賽的最後一天了!這三十天真的過得又快又充實。從一開始覺得每天要發一篇文章好像不太可能,到現在居然真的堅持下來,心裡其實滿有成就感的。 一開始參加的時...

2025-10-15 ‧ 由 aydan3199 分享